Art lovers will find
closed homesickness about gone ages when Cuban bourgeoisie was fixing
style's age tracking at the 17th street Palacette in Vedado section,
old Count of Revilla Camargo's residence, today Decorative Art Museum.
Project was sketched in Paris by French architects P. Virad and
M. Destugue, under the direction of Cuban architect Alberto Camacho
and decoration also by the Jansen House, of the French capital where
the only used Cuban material was the wood for doors and windows
made in carved mahogany. The elegant simplicity of the facade, of
a rested classicism, is full of beauty, clear and energized.
With a centered body, balconies and terraces, made with practical
and functional architecture, faithful testimony
of how the constructors knew to incorporate the elegant and polished
curves to the stereometry of the clear classic forms. The building
with two plants, beautifully provided and structured with harmony
(constructed between 1924 and 1927, and restructured near by the
30 decade have been restored again in 2003) and gathers part of
the history of the Cuban bourgeoisie. The interior, the lobby and
facade has been restored, for almost practically have its original
shine.
It is one of the most singular museums of the American continent,
possibly only in Latin America and in addition to his rich cultural
and historical meaning, it is a scope for the visual contemplation.
The museum feature 23 collections and near 35 thousand pieces
in its stock, whose main attractive till the moment, is related
with French XVIII century. Part of the objects belonged to Revilla
Camargo and Oscar B. Cintas own collections, and are located through
both floors which conform the building.
The luxuriant artistic wealth that decorates walls and ceilings,
the wealth of the furniture due to cabinetmakers as important as
Chippendale or the French Boudin, Chevalier, Simoneau and others
and the fine porcelains of Sévres, Chantilly, Meissen, Limoges
or the English manufactures of Standforshire and Wedgwood, carry
most visitor into the scope of the private life of Gómez
Mena, Cintas and some other who owned the institution stock.

El The museum route is circling, leaving the building by where
you got inside. After to get the decorative inner step way to the
second floor and left back the clear lobby and two great linen cloths
of Hubert Robert, gobelinos can be appreciated on the dinning room
with walls covered by Italian marbles, with a dinning table served
for 24 persons and trophies of mercury plate bronze with allegories
and attributes Regency style.
